Five years after the catastrophic June 9, 2021 storms devastated Kalorama, the mountain community has shown deep resilience while grappling with a long, complex recovery. Over 20,000 trees were uprooted across the Dandenong Ranges by highly unusual, destructive east coast low-pressure winds, leaving the township of Kalorama as one of the hardest-hit "ground zero" locations.
Despite feeling largely isolated from government assistance in the initial chaotic days, the Kalorama and wider Dandenongβs community rallied together, our community spirit was strong. Neighbours supported one another by setting up impromptu hubs, sharing generators, and offering meals, cementing a powerful legacy of local camaraderie and support that remains five years later.
